PowerShell系列(一):PowerShell介绍和cmd命令行的区别

这篇具有很好参考价值的文章主要介绍了PowerShell系列(一):PowerShell介绍和cmd命令行的区别。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

目录

1、cmd命令行窗口有哪些缺点呢?

2、PowerShell的产生

3、PowerShell优点

4、PowerShell使用场景


什么是Windows系统的命令行环境,之前我们在使用XP、Win7系统的时候,用的最多的就是微软官方自带的cmd命令窗口了,我们通过敲命令行窗口可以实现和操作系统之间的交互。当然随着微软技术的快速发展,到了目前比较流行的Win10操作系统,默认采用的就是PowerShell命令行交互工具了,今天小编就来给大家介绍Powershell相关的知识,希望对大家学习能带来一些帮助!

1、cmd命令行窗口有哪些缺点呢?

PowerShell系列(一):PowerShell介绍和cmd命令行的区别

  • 窗口背景单一,基本就是黑色背景、白色字体,几乎没有美化的可能。
  • dos命令不是自然语言,命令没有太多的规律,编写难度大、很难记忆。所以dos命令高手相对还是很少的。
  • 针对命令参数没有tab按键自动补全功能,参数几乎全靠记忆。
  • 学习成本非常高,想做到通过dos命令实现操作系统的运维还是非常困难的

2、PowerShell的产生

PowerShell系列(一):PowerShell介绍和cmd命令行的区别

微软官方从Win7操作系统就内置了PowerShell1.0版本。有了它加速了Windows平台自动化运维的进程。它的出现也让cmd命令行窗口慢慢淡化,不过微软官方为了兼容早期的版本,还是保留下来。

3、PowerShell优点

PowerShell系列(一):PowerShell介绍和cmd命令行的区别

  • 整体界面更加美观大方易用
  • 命令参数自动补全,大大提升了代码编写效率
  • powershell属于自然语言,可读性高,比较容易理解和学习
  • 可以轻松地自动化任务和脚本编写,减少日常操作的繁琐性,增加工作效率。
  • 与 Windows 操作系统无缝集成,可以很方便地管理 Windows系统 及其组件。
  • 强大的对象管道处理能力,可以快速生成和处理对象并以可视化的方式表示输出结果。
  • 支持丰富的命令、函数和模块,可以扩展和自定义功能,实现更高级的脚本编写。
  • 支持多种编程语言,包括 C#、VB.NET 和 PowerShell,可以快速编写和重用现有的代码。
  • 能够安全地执行命令和脚本,保障系统和数据的安全性。
  • 支持远程管理,可以在本地或远程计算机上执行命令和脚本。
  • 易于学习和使用,有多种教程和文档,可以帮助用户快速掌握使用技巧。

官方文档:PowerShell 文档 - PowerShell | Microsoft Learn

4、PowerShell使用场景

PowerShell是一种Windows操作系统的命令行脚本语言,也可以编写成脚本文件,用途非常广泛。简单介绍如下:文章来源地址https://www.toymoban.com/news/detail-460227.html

  • 广泛应用于Windows服务器、企业管理、自动化脚本开发等领域。
  • 可以帮助管理员进行系统配置、文件操作、程序管理、网络管理、安全设置等任务。
  • 也可以用于管理Active Directory、Exchange Server、SQL Server、SharePoint等Microsoft家族产品。 
  • 还可以用于与外部Web服务、API接口进行交互,以便于开发实现自动化管理或者定制化的工作流程。

到了这里,关于PowerShell系列(一):PowerShell介绍和cmd命令行的区别的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包赞助服务器费用

相关文章

  • PowerShell系列(十三):PowerShell Cmdlet高级参数介绍(三)

    PowerShell系列(十三):PowerShell Cmdlet高级参数介绍(三)

    目录 1、WarningAction参数 2、WarningVariable 出现警告后的变量 3、Whatif 假设参数 4、Confirm参数 今天给大家讲解PowerShell Cmdlet高级参数第三部分相关的知识,希望对大家学习PowerShell能有所帮助! 通过单词含义,就可以理解WarningAction参数和执行命令过程中的警告有关系,该参数就

    2024年02月07日
    浏览(6)
  • 命令提示符(CMD)切换到指定目录的方法

    命令提示符(CMD)切换到指定目录的方法

    通常我们把像是java,mysql,python等语言类工具放到自定义目录,而不是默认路径,使用cmd命令提示符想查看版本信息的时候需要到指定目录,这时候就需要掌握切换到指定目录的方法。 命令提示符(cmd)只在当前盘符切换目录时,可以先到目标目录上复制地址, 输入 即可切

    2024年02月11日
    浏览(8)
  • 电脑在cmd命令行下快速切换目录文件

    电脑在cmd命令行下快速切换目录文件

    文章目录: 第一部分: 快速切换目录文件 1.切换到指定磁盘 2.目录之间切换  3.切换到指定目录通过cmd 4.相关命令 第二部分:电脑常用Win+R快捷命令 第三部分:Windows10 触摸板手势  最好以管理员身份运行 切换到指定磁盘— 磁盘名称: cd cd~ cd- cd. cd.. cd/ cd./ cd../.. cd!$ cd /h

    2024年02月09日
    浏览(5)
  • PowerShell系列(二):PowerShell和Python之间的差异介绍

    PowerShell系列(二):PowerShell和Python之间的差异介绍

    目录 1、Python定义 2、Python用途 4、PowerShell用途 5、PowerShell和Python对比 5.1 共同点 5.2 不同点 6、总结 今天给大家聊聊PowerShell和Python之间有哪些共同之处,各自有哪些优势,希望对运维的朋友了解两种语言能提供一些有用的信息。 Python是一种面向对象的解释型计算机程序设计

    2024年02月05日
    浏览(10)
  • PowerShell系列(八)PowerShell系统默认内置的Provider介绍

    PowerShell系列(八)PowerShell系统默认内置的Provider介绍

    往期回顾 PowerShell系列(一):PowerShell介绍和cmd命令行的区别 PowerShell系列(二):PowerShell和Python之间的差异介绍 PowerShell系列(三):PowerShell发展历程梳理 PowerShell系列(四):PowerShell进入交互环境的三种方式 PowerShell系列(五):PowerShell通过脚本方式运行笔记 PowerShell系

    2024年02月11日
    浏览(3)
  • cmd常用命令:更换文件夹、切换路径、查看目录和返回根目录和子目录

    cmd常用命令:更换文件夹、切换路径、查看目录和返回根目录和子目录

    打开cmd:快捷键 Win+R,输入cmd 打开cmd之后,默认是在C:Users电脑路径 文件夹中 更换磁盘:输入D:,然后回车 +dir查看当前目录 cd…可以返回上一级目录 cd 返回到根目录 输入 cd 文件夹名, 可以进入子文件夹 例如输入 cd Program Files/Java/jdk-19/ 【注意反斜杠】 cmd命令打开及切换目

    2023年04月18日
    浏览(60)
  • bat 打开 cmd 跳转某个目录并执行某些命令

    bat 打开 cmd 跳转某个目录并执行某些命令

    当遇到多条命令要在 cmd 下执行时,可以用 bat 脚本一次性执行所有命令 例如: 要跳转到桌面名为sentinel的文件夹下,用java -jar执行里面的jar包 普通情况下,Windows+R打开cmd,切换到sentinel文件夹,再执行 java -jar 现在只需要执行 bat 文件,文件内容: start cmd /k \\\"cd /d C:Userseoi

    2024年02月16日
    浏览(22)
  • windows的cmd命令窗口介绍

    windows的cmd命令窗口介绍

    1.打开cmd 1.1.方式一 左下角搜索:“运行” - 打开 输入\\\"cmd\\\" - 确定 1.2.方式二 直接使用快捷键 windows + r 即可打开 然后输入cmd,点击确认 1.3.方式三 打开文件管理器,输入cmd,回车 即可在该文件路径下打开命令行: 2.文件路径表示 2.1.绝对路径 以盘符开始的路径:D:IBMILOGC

    2024年02月07日
    浏览(11)
  • 【BAT】win10 命令行工具cmd乱码解决方案及cmd非常用命令chcp介绍

    【BAT】win10 命令行工具cmd乱码解决方案及cmd非常用命令chcp介绍

    修改cmd的编码格式 临时更改:更改当前cmd命令窗口编码格式(关闭当前窗口后,重新开启又回到原先的编码格式) (1)进入cmd命令窗口:window + R,输入cmd (2)直接输入chcp 65001,按回车键/Enter 永久更改:将cmd命令窗口的编码格式永久设置为utf-8 (1)进入注册表编辑器:window + R,

    2024年02月04日
    浏览(7)
  • powershell中文乱码 windows cmd

    问题的起因是windoes默认字符编码是GBK,而目前通用字符集使用的是UTF-8 关于字符集的问题欢迎移架到 字符集 最终解决方案 为使用最新的windows特性,将默认字符集切换到UTF-8 方法1. 进入控制面板 - 时钟和区域 - 区域 - 管理 - 更改系统区域设置 - 勾选Beta版:使用 UnicodeUTF-8提供全

    2024年02月02日
    浏览(6)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包